So begins Paul Auster's The Brooklyn Follies, set against the backdrop of the contested US presidential election of 2000. Nathan and Tom are an uncle and nephew double-act - one in remission from lung cancer, divorced, and estranged from his only daughter, the other hiding away from what was a once-promising academic career. By accident the pair wind up in the same Brooklyn neighborhood, and then matters change for them further when Lucy - a little girl who refuses to speak - comes into their lives, offering a bridge from the pasts of both men and, perhaps, a shot at redemption.
